Before becoming the legendary cornerback we all know today, Deion Sanders-now famously known as "Coach Prime," and formerly as "Prime Time"-played quarterback in high school. He insists that this early experience under center gave him a unique perspective on the game, helping him understand how defenses think and allowing him to anticipate them with precision.
